31/// Try to emit a base destructor as an alias to its primary
32/// base-class destructor.
33bool CodeGenModule::TryEmitBaseDestructorAsAlias(const CXXDestructorDecl *D) {
34  if (!getCodeGenOpts().CXXCtorDtorAliases)
35    return true;
36
37  // Producing an alias to a base class ctor/dtor can degrade debug quality
38  // as the debugger cannot tell them apart.
39  if (getCodeGenOpts().OptimizationLevel == 0)
40    return true;
41
42  // If sanitizing memory to check for use-after-dtor, do not emit as
43  //  an alias, unless this class owns no members.
44  if (getCodeGenOpts().SanitizeMemoryUseAfterDtor &&
45      !D->getParent()->field_empty())
46    return true;
47
48  // If the destructor doesn't have a trivial body, we have to emit it
49  // separately.
50  if (!D->hasTrivialBody())
51    return true;
52
53  const CXXRecordDecl *Class = D->getParent();
54
55  // We are going to instrument this destructor, so give up even if it is
56  // currently empty.
57  if (Class->mayInsertExtraPadding())
58    return true;
59
60  // If we need to manipulate a VTT parameter, give up.
61  if (Class->getNumVBases()) {
62    // Extra Credit:  passing extra parameters is perfectly safe
63    // in many calling conventions, so only bail out if the ctor's
64    // calling convention is nonstandard.
65    return true;
66  }
67
68  // If any field has a non-trivial destructor, we have to emit the
69  // destructor separately.
70  for (const auto *I : Class->fields())
71    if (I->getType().isDestructedType())
72      return true;
73
74  // Try to find a unique base class with a non-trivial destructor.
75  const CXXRecordDecl *UniqueBase = nullptr;
76  for (const auto &I : Class->bases()) {
77
78    // We're in the base destructor, so skip virtual bases.
79    if (I.isVirtual()) continue;
80
81    // Skip base classes with trivial destructors.
82    const auto *Base =
83        cast<CXXRecordDecl>(I.getType()->castAs<RecordType>()->getDecl());
84    if (Base->hasTrivialDestructor()) continue;
85
86    // If we've already found a base class with a non-trivial
87    // destructor, give up.
88    if (UniqueBase) return true;
89    UniqueBase = Base;
90  }
91
92  // If we didn't find any bases with a non-trivial destructor, then
93  // the base destructor is actually effectively trivial, which can
94  // happen if it was needlessly user-defined or if there are virtual
95  // bases with non-trivial destructors.
96  if (!UniqueBase)
97    return true;
98
99  // If the base is at a non-zero offset, give up.
100  const ASTRecordLayout &ClassLayout = Context.getASTRecordLayout(Class);
101  if (!ClassLayout.getBaseClassOffset(UniqueBase).isZero())
102    return true;
103
104  // Give up if the calling conventions don't match. We could update the call,
105  // but it is probably not worth it.
106  const CXXDestructorDecl *BaseD = UniqueBase->getDestructor();
107  if (BaseD->getType()->castAs<FunctionType>()->getCallConv() !=
108      D->getType()->castAs<FunctionType>()->getCallConv())
109    return true;
110
111  GlobalDecl AliasDecl(D, Dtor_Base);
112  GlobalDecl TargetDecl(BaseD, Dtor_Base);
113
114  // The alias will use the linkage of the referent.  If we can't
115  // support aliases with that linkage, fail.
116  llvm::GlobalValue::LinkageTypes Linkage = getFunctionLinkage(AliasDecl);
117
118  // We can't use an alias if the linkage is not valid for one.
119  if (!llvm::GlobalAlias::isValidLinkage(Linkage))
120    return true;
121
122  llvm::GlobalValue::LinkageTypes TargetLinkage =
123      getFunctionLinkage(TargetDecl);
124
125  // Check if we have it already.
126  StringRef MangledName = getMangledName(AliasDecl);
127  llvm::GlobalValue *Entry = GetGlobalValue(MangledName);
128  if (Entry && !Entry->isDeclaration())
129    return false;
130  if (Replacements.count(MangledName))
131    return false;
132
133  // Derive the type for the alias.
134  llvm::Type *AliasValueType = getTypes().GetFunctionType(AliasDecl);
135  llvm::PointerType *AliasType = AliasValueType->getPointerTo();
136
137  // Find the referent.  Some aliases might require a bitcast, in
138  // which case the caller is responsible for ensuring the soundness
139  // of these semantics.
140  auto *Ref = cast<llvm::GlobalValue>(GetAddrOfGlobal(TargetDecl));
141  llvm::Constant *Aliasee = Ref;
142  if (Ref->getType() != AliasType)
143    Aliasee = llvm::ConstantExpr::getBitCast(Ref, AliasType);
144
145  // Instead of creating as alias to a linkonce_odr, replace all of the uses
146  // of the aliasee.
147  if (llvm::GlobalValue::isDiscardableIfUnused(Linkage) &&
148      !(TargetLinkage == llvm::GlobalValue::AvailableExternallyLinkage &&
149        TargetDecl.getDecl()->hasAttr<AlwaysInlineAttr>())) {
150    // FIXME: An extern template instantiation will create functions with
151    // linkage "AvailableExternally". In libc++, some classes also define
152    // members with attribute "AlwaysInline" and expect no reference to
153    // be generated. It is desirable to reenable this optimisation after
154    // corresponding LLVM changes.
155    addReplacement(MangledName, Aliasee);
156    return false;
157  }
158
159  // If we have a weak, non-discardable alias (weak, weak_odr), like an extern
160  // template instantiation or a dllexported class, avoid forming it on COFF.
161  // A COFF weak external alias cannot satisfy a normal undefined symbol
162  // reference from another TU. The other TU must also mark the referenced
163  // symbol as weak, which we cannot rely on.
164  if (llvm::GlobalValue::isWeakForLinker(Linkage) &&
165      getTriple().isOSBinFormatCOFF()) {
166    return true;
167  }
168
169  // If we don't have a definition for the destructor yet or the definition is
170  // avaialable_externally, don't emit an alias.  We can't emit aliases to
171  // declarations; that's just not how aliases work.
172  if (Ref->isDeclarationForLinker())
173    return true;
174
175  // Don't create an alias to a linker weak symbol. This avoids producing
176  // different COMDATs in different TUs. Another option would be to
177  // output the alias both for weak_odr and linkonce_odr, but that
178  // requires explicit comdat support in the IL.
179  if (llvm::GlobalValue::isWeakForLinker(TargetLinkage))
180    return true;
181
182  // Create the alias with no name.
183  auto *Alias = llvm::GlobalAlias::create(AliasValueType, 0, Linkage, "",
184                                          Aliasee, &getModule());
185
186  // Destructors are always unnamed_addr.
187  Alias->setUnnamedAddr(llvm::GlobalValue::UnnamedAddr::Global);
188
189  // Switch any previous uses to the alias.
190  if (Entry) {
191    assert(Entry->getType() == AliasType &&
192           "declaration exists with different type");
193    Alias->takeName(Entry);
194    Entry->replaceAllUsesWith(Alias);
195    Entry->eraseFromParent();
196  } else {
197    Alias->setName(MangledName);
198  }
199
200  // Finally, set up the alias with its proper name and attributes.
201  SetCommonAttributes(AliasDecl, Alias);
202
203  return false;
204}
